Why Everyone Is Suddenly So Interested in the US Bond Markets
A few years ago, when you mentioned the bond market at a dinner party, you probably got a few blank stares before someone moved on to stocks, real estate, or Bitcoin, which were easier to understand. However, fast forward to the present day, and the bond market in the United States has suddenly become the topic of conversation. People are spending a lot of time researching yields, treasury auctions, and the dreaded "inverted yield curve"—from financial analysts on YouTube to everyday conversations on Reddit. But the sudden interest: why?

The Subscription Society: Renting Happiness in a World That No Longer Sells It. AI-Generated.
Imagine waking up one morning and realizing that nothing in your life is truly yours—not your apartment, not your furniture, not even your playlists. You don’t own your entertainment; you stream it. You don’t own your clothes; you subscribe to monthly fashion drops. You don’t even own your data; it's leased to the highest bidder. Welcome to the Subscription Society, where permanence is passé, and everything—including happiness—comes with a recurring fee.
